Output 9882723586aed360f2965521cdf33a2fc4ef91dccb7172ce97e33f144d8a80a1:0

value
5963194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ca6b53bb3d3cd4c09f7f3ec8fb81cb3b06a265bd OP_EQUAL
address
3L9JzWW586E4AsT7cYihZTdePYCxpCeMH4
transaction
9882723586aed360f2965521cdf33a2fc4ef91dccb7172ce97e33f144d8a80a1
confirmations
345017
spent
true